Output d383afbdfd76934eb1664ed759e64724dfe3ce0dbdcad7434569949352367426:0

value
20345783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7fb575f084044af8edab574b67a54f4dbf584a5 OP_EQUAL
address
3Nqd7MbGfFRx7ASk61Xre6VKCem5AakBLJ
transaction
d383afbdfd76934eb1664ed759e64724dfe3ce0dbdcad7434569949352367426
spent
true